from types import NoneType
from ansible.errors import AnsibleParserError
def load_list_of_blocks(ds, role=None, loader=None):
'''
Given a list of mixed task/block data (parsed from YAML),
return a list of Block() objects, where implicit blocks
are created for each bare Task.
'''
# we import here to prevent a circular dependency with imports
from ansible.playbook.block import Block
assert type(ds) in (list, NoneType)
block_list = []
if ds:
for block in ds:
b = Block.load(block, role=role, loader=loader)
block_list.append(b)
return block_list
def load_list_of_tasks(ds, block=None, role=None, task_include=None, loader=None):
'''
Given a list of task datastructures (parsed from YAML),
return a list of Task() or TaskInclude() objects.
'''
# we import here to prevent a circular dependency with imports
from ansible.playbook.task import Task
from ansible.playbook.task_include import TaskInclude
assert type(ds) == list
task_list = []
for task in ds:
if not isinstance(task, dict):
raise AnsibleParserError("task/handler entries must be dictionaries (got a %s)" % type(task), obj=ds)
if 'include' in task:
t = TaskInclude.load(task, block=block, role=role, task_include=task_include, loader=loader)
else:
t = Task.load(task, block=block, role=role, task_include=task_include, loader=loader)
task_list.append(t)
return task_list
def load_list_of_roles(ds, loader=None):
'''
Loads and returns a list of RoleInclude objects from the datastructure
list of role definitions
'''
# we import here to prevent a circular dependency with imports
from ansible.playbook.role.include import RoleInclude
assert isinstance(ds, list)
roles = []
for role_def in ds:
i = RoleInclude.load(role_def, loader=loader)
roles.append(i)
return roles
